Key Responsibilities

  • •Manage assigned mechanical design projects from sales order review to handover to production.
  • •Perform project design, processing, and supporting activities for the assigned product range.
  • •Review customer project design specifications and collaborate with Sales/Tendering to engineer solutions from order requirements.
  • •Prepare and review customer-facing documents including pump cross section, general arrangement, P&ID, and wiring diagrams in 2D/3D; review buyout component drawings and documents.
  • •Prepare/check/release BOMs in ERP, coordinate with operations/purchase/sales/quality/testing through order execution, and support pump site commissioning until successful operation.
Travel: Low travel

Key Requirements

  • •3-8 years of related engineering experience, including manufacturing, EPCs, and/or oil and gas industry.
  • •Experience in centrifugal pump engineering with knowledge and interpretation of applicable industry standards (e.g., API-610, API 682, ASME Pressure Vessel Code, ASME standards, AGMA, NACE).
  • •Hands-on experience with AutoCAD design software; experience with NX, engineering base, and Teamcenter is an added advantage.
  • •ERP experience (JDE experience is an added advantage).
  • •Bachelor’s in mechanical engineering and ability to travel to customer/supplier sites on a limited basis.
